In journalism, as opposed to internet forums, quotes are used to convey something someone else has literally said instead of representing something in a mocking tone. Someone called it torture (potentially an expert in calling things torture) so they used quotes to say "we're not calling this torture, someone more educated in this topic called it torture and we are leaning on their expertise to know what they're talking about"
